You receive an email asking you to forward it to four other people to ensure prosperity. Assuming the chain isn't broken, how many emails will have been received and sent after 8 email generations, including yours?

Answer:

Total number of emails send after 8 email generation is given as

4+16+64+256+1024+4096+16384+65536=87380

Number of email received after 8 email generation is given as

1+4+16+64+256+1024+4096+16384=21845

Step-by-step explanation:

In this question it is given that First email is send to four peoples

Therefore in  generation-1

Number of email received=1

Number of email sent by first person=[tex]4[/tex]

generation-2

Number of email send by 4 persons if each send 4 email[tex]=4\times4=16[/tex]

generation-3

Number of email send by 16 persons if each send 4 email[tex]=16\times4=64[/tex]

generation-4

Number of email send by 64 persons if each send 4 email[tex]=64\times4=256[/tex]

generation-5

Number of email send by 256 persons if each send 4 email=[tex]256\times4=1024[/tex]

generation-6

Number of email send by 1024 persons if each send 4 email[tex]=1024\times4=4096[/tex]

generation-7

Number of email send by 4096  persons if each send 4 email[tex]=4096\times4=16384[/tex]

Generation-8

Number of email send by 16384 persons if each send 4 email[tex]=16384\times4=65536[/tex]

therefore, Total number of emails send after 8 email generation is given as

[tex]4+16+64+256+1024+4096+16384+65536=87380[/tex]

Number of email received after 8 email generation is given as

[tex]1+4+16+64+256+1024+4096+16384=21845[/tex]
